Abstract
A capacitor is connected in parallel with a saturated core coil assembly (a nonlinear load) to reduce the magnetizing current. A linear reactor is connected in series with supply to reduce the distortion in supply current. This typical reactor capacitor filter system has been analyzed by an iterative procedure based on harmonic equivalent circuits. The analysis presented here predicts the harmonic resonance points of the circuit with good accuracy. The technique is applicable, in general, to any nonlinear load.
